What safety and fabric considerations should I check for baby clothing and accessories?
Safety hinges on choosing soft, hypoallergenic fabrics and avoiding small detachable parts that could pose choking hazards. Look for breathable cotton blends for pajamas or bodysuits and ensure seams are smooth to prevent irritation. For dark or black fabrics, ensure the dye is color-fast and tested for baby wear. Always review washing instructions to maintain fabric integrity and minimize potential irritants on delicate baby skin.

How do I care for baby items to maintain color and fabric integrity in dark colors?
Wash on gentle cycles with mild, baby-safe detergents and avoid high-temperature drying that can fade colors. Turn dark garments inside-out before washing to reduce rubbing, and air-dry when possible to preserve fabric strength. For items with mixed fabrics, follow the most delicate care instructions. Regular gentle care keeps dark-colored baby basics soft and comfortable for longer use.
